Navigating Regulations and Safety

UK charters follow strict guidelines for a safe experience. For bareboat charters, you'll need qualifications like an RYA Day Skipper certificate, but skippered options handle this for you UK Government Maritime Safety. Key rules include safety equipment mandates and environmental protections, with a push toward electric boats to reduce emissions.

What qualifications do I need for boat charter UK? For skippered charters, none — just enjoy the ride. Bareboat requires RYA certification or equivalent.

How much does private boat hire London cost? Prices start at £200-500 per hour for small groups, varying by vessel and duration VisitBritain.

Are there eco-friendly options for luxury boat hire UK? Yes, hybrid and electric boats are booming, aligning with UK sustainability goals.
